The Jupiler Pro League typically features 16 teams (though formats may evolve) competing over a season. Each club plays others home and away, accumulating points (3 for a win, 1 for a draw, 0 for a loss). The table ranks teams based on:
Total Points
Goal Difference (goals scored minus goals conceded)
Goals Scored (as further tie-breaker)
Through this ranking, fans and bettors can quickly see which clubs are in contention for the title, European places, or stuck in relegation battles. Current live standings show, for example, Union Saint?Gilloise leading with strong form in the 2025-26 season. World Soccer Data+2Forza Football+2
While the table gives a straightforward ranking, it also hides deeper signals:
A high number of points with a high goal difference indicates dominance.
A team with many draws may have consistency but lacks finishing edge.
A club near the bottom but with several matches in hand may still climb.
Tracking home vs away performance (not always shown in simple tables) can expose teams vulnerable on the road.

Unlike some European leagues with straightforward home-and-away formats, Belgium’s “Play-Off” system can alter dynamics: after the regular season, teams may go into championship or relegation playoffs, with points halved or other adjustments. For example, the 2023-24 season used a format where the top six competed in a championship round. Wikipedia+1
This format means:
A club sitting 6th after regular season may still contend for title in playoffs.
Standings early in the season may shift significantly after format changes.
Betting on Belgian league should account for these structural steps and what part of the season you are in.
